champion a person or animal that has taken first place in a contest or game; winner.
dairy a business that makes and sells milk, butter, and cheese.
hug the action of holding using both arms.
luck something that happens by chance.
muscle the soft pieces of flesh in animals and humans that make the bones move.
needle a thin tool made of steel with a hole at one end and a sharp point at the other end. You put thread through the hole. Needles are used for sewing.
nonsense words that have no meaning or make no sense.
replace to put something in the place of another thing.
shield a large, flat piece of strong material carried on the arm for protection.
skate to move over ice or another hard surface using shoes that have a blade or wheels attached to the bottom.
stove a device that uses electricity, gas, or oil to provide heat for cooking or warmth.
suitcase a box used for carrying clothing and personal things when traveling.
trash anything that is thrown away because it is not wanted.
untrue not correct or accurate; false.
usual most common; normal.
